Om mig
Nenad Bogdanovic is Professor in Geriatric Medicine, specialist and senior consultant in neurogeriatric, affiliate professor at Oslo University and visiting Professor at Boston University and University of Zagreb. He is a clinician, researcher on neurodegenerative disorders with expertise in geriatric, neurology, neuropathology and neuroanatomy with the specific interest in clinical diagnostics and development of early diagnostic biomarkers. He has a successful track record of achievement as a Head of Huddinge Brain Bank, co-chair of European Brain bank Consortium, Head of Neurogeriatric Clinic, Head of R&D as well as EU Medical Director in Neuroscience and Alzheimer’s disease Therapeutics in Pharma companies Wyeth and Pfizer, with the specific focus on antibodies against Alzheimer disease. He is a co-founder of BrainNet Europe, holder of three innovative patents.
